Output 18d8c57d04a6bc7a0d7957fa24c232764e0e25dab040450c7782a9dde06319ad:4

value
39800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9bfbd84a64edd1a514bcbe5715d7a89b4642eaf OP_EQUAL
address
3L5mST9Zk5k8zrCt8mrYuvbrBsZhGBbt3t
transaction
18d8c57d04a6bc7a0d7957fa24c232764e0e25dab040450c7782a9dde06319ad
spent
true